Description Along with the three main pieces, the art show contained four slightly smaller fully colored pieces that focussed more on the secondary characters and on the life within Crossworld. This one I'm quite proud of due to the massive amount of lighting involved in it. My art teacher, who'd been pounding lighting into my head the past years, pointed at it with a loud victorious exclamation of "HA!"

I took that as a good sign. XD

Here be a couple quite unusual and fun characters of Crossworld, my doofy wizard who's more sharp-witted than he lets on, A. Aurum, and his beautiful, exotic, and dangerous djinn, Khalida, created by . Aurum runs a small magic shop within the city, and no one knows just how long it's been there... You can find all sorts of oddities there, from cursed bracers of water-breathing to the silver zucchini of truth.


Crossworld and the characters are the original work of myself, Nyx (aka Pointy), and Star, so please no taking of characters or art for personal use!
